Nacho Cheeseless Sauce
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 5 Minutes
Ready In: 10 Minutes
Servings: 12
This vegan replacement for nacho cheese will be a hit the next time you need a snack or are having a party.It's from the Teen's Vegetarian Cookbook. You can use lemon juice or Dijon mustard if you don't like nutritional yeast.
Ingredients:
12 ounces silken tofu
1/2 cup salsa
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on turmeric
2 tablespoons nutritional yeast
1/4 cup water
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
2 tablespoons canned green chilies, chopped (optional)
Directions:
1. Mix water and cornstarch.
2. In a blender, puree tofu, salsa, salt, turmeric, and water-cornstarch mixture. Add nutritional yeast.
3. Heat oil in a skillet and make bottom of pan is coated. Pour in tofu mixture and spread to cover pan.
4. Cook tofu mixture on low heat for about 5 minutes, without stirring.
5. Use a wooden spoon or spatula to mix up the tofu, stirring to get a creamy consistency.
6. Pour/scrape sauce into a bowl and serve with any combination of chips, beans, lettuce, and/or tomato.
